As soon as wrapped, attach one particular conclusion of your fuel line to the dryer inlet fitting and hand tighten. Location the opposite conclusion of your adaptable fuel line around the fuel supply line and hand tighten it. Utilizing an adjustable wrench, tighten Each and every link firmly until eventually cosy. Will not about-tighten. Take a look at the gasoline link by turning the gas valve towards the ON situation, Hence the take care of is parallel for the gas line. Look for leaks by brushing a soapy drinking water Remedy onto the gas connections. If you see any bubbles, the connection is leaking and has to be tightened. If you still can not get an excellent seal with no bubbles, simply call the gasoline organization or maybe a plumber for guidance.
